Metal Cut-to-Length Line

MaxDo metal cut-to-length lines convert coils into flat sheets and blanks through decoiling, leveling, NC length control, precision shearing, conveying, and stacking. Cut-to-length model selection matrix

Model routeBest-fit production scopeEvidence to confirm before RFQ

CT-850 compact cut-to-length line300-820 mm coils, compact flat sheets, HVAC panels, appliance skins, and small-blank programs.Coil width, thickness, flatness target, length tolerance, shear edge, stack method, site layout, and FAT/SAT records.
CT-1350 mid-width cut-to-length line300-1350 mm coils, panel work, stamping preparation, fabrication blanks, and mid-width sheet programs.Yield strength, sheet length range, surface rule, stack alignment, shear timing, flatness release, and operator handoff.
CT-1650 wide cut-to-length line300-1650 mm coils, wider flat sheets, service-center output, appliance panels, and mixed-width blank programs.Installation space, crane route, safety zone, surface marks, length accuracy, stack release, and SAT acceptance records.

CTL category FAQ
Which CTL model should be checked first? Start with CT-850 for compact sheet output, CT-1350 for mid-width sheet programs, and CT-1650 when wider sheet capacity or future mixed-width production matters.
What should be sent with a CTL RFQ? Send coil width, thickness range, material strength, flatness target, sheet length, length tolerance, shear edge requirement, stack method, layout constraints, and FAT/SAT acceptance requirements through the MaxDo contact form.

Что такое линия резки металла по длине?

Линия продольной резки металла - это промышленное оборудование, которое автоматически разматывает, выпрямляет, измеряет и разрезает рулоны металла на точные плоские листы заданной длины. Она необходима для обработки стали и производства.

Какие материалы можно обрабатывать на станках продольной резки?

Линии резки по длине могут обрабатывать различные металлы, включая сталь, алюминий, нержавеющую сталь, медь и другие металлические рулоны различной толщины и ширины, обычно от 0,5 мм до 16 мм.

Каковы основные преимущества использования линии резки по длине?

К основным преимуществам относятся высокая точность резки, повышение эффективности производства, сокращение отходов материала, стабильное качество листов и автоматизированная работа, сводящая к минимуму потребность в ручном труде.
